Q: What happens if a Hollowgate webhook delivery fails? A: We retry with exponential backoff — five attempts over roughly 30 minutes, then the event moves to a dead-letter queue held for seven days. Receivers must return a 2xx within ten seconds; anything else counts as a failure. Duplicate deliveries are possible, so handlers should be idempotent. Full retry schedules and replay instructions are on the internal page below.

wiki page, tahaf-tajog: https://jira.ordindyn.corp/pipeline

# Fixture: retry_failed_exports
#
# This fixture simulates the Ledgerhop export pipeline after three
# consecutive failures, so support can reproduce the exact retry
# backoff customers report. The mock export service expects every
# retry request to carry a bearer token; without one, it returns a
# 401 and the retry counter does not increment, which masks the bug.
# The token below is fixture-only and has no production scope.
# Paste it into the AUTH header before running the suite:

session JWT of yawep-yawep = eyJhbGciOiJIUzI1NiIsInR5cCI6IkpXVCJ9.eyJzdWIiOiI3pWF3_In0.aXYsHiog

Ticket: Basement archive room — shelving repair

Site: Greywell Depot, lower level B2. The archive room off the plant corridor has two collapsed shelving bays; boxed records have been moved to pallets pending repair. Contractors from Aldbury Fitout attending Wednesday, 08:00–12:00. Sign in at the goods entrance, wear issued hi-vis, and keep the corridor fire door closed at all times. No records are to be removed from the room. Lighting in B2 is on a timer; the switch panel is inside the door. Enter using the code below.

staff pass of kawip-hawef = bdg-QLP-2

**Ticket: ChipGate reader drops splits at the 10K mat**

Hey folks — the Velomark ChipGate units at the Harrowfield Marathon keep missing splits when runners bunch up at the 10K mat. Looks like the antenna multiplexer falls behind above ~40 reads/sec. Repro by replaying the Harrowfield pack data through the sim rig. The failing firmware build is noted below.

pipeline stamp: htk9_6ce9d33c5